cadbury egg cookies
| fresh milled flour

yield: ~21 large cookies
prep time: 20 min
bake time: 10–12 min
rest time: 10–15 min
total: ~40–50 min

ingredients

  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up light brown sugar, packed
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s, room temp
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 2 2/3 cups (≈453 g) fresh milled soft white wheat flour, fine grind
  • 2 tsp cornstarch
  • 1 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1 1/2 tsp salt
  • 2–4 tbsp milk or cream
  • 2 1/2–3 cups crushed cadbury eggs

instructions

  1. preheat your oven to 350 f (177 c). line ba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. in a medium bowl whisk together the flour, cornstarch, baking soda, and salt. set aside.
  3. in a large bowl or stand mixer cream the butter and sugars together until light and fluffy (2–3 min).
  4. beat in eggs and vanilla until smooth.
  5. g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et, mixing just until combined.
  6. add 2-4 tbsp milk or cream and mix. dough should be soft but not sticky. add more if needed.
  7. fold in crushed cadbury eggs, save some for topping if you want.
  8. rest the dough for 10–15 min to allow the flour to fully hydrate.
  9. scoop dough into 2–3 tbsp portions. roll into slightly tall mounds and do not flatten.
  10. bake 10–14 min or until edges are set and centers look soft and slightly underdone.
  11. cool 5–9 min on the baking sheet, then transfer to a wire rack to cool another 10–20 min.

fresh milled flour tips

  • resting the dough helps hydrate the bran and improves texture. skipping this step can lead to crumbly cookies.
  • fresh milled flour absorbs more liquid. adjust with a small amount of milk or cream if the dough feels dry.
  • don’t over bake. whole grain cookies brown faster and will continue to set as they cool.
  • for best texture, mill flour very fine. a coarser grind will give a more rustic result.
  • optional: chill dough 20 min if cookies spread too much.
